VELA Investment Management LLC lifted its position in shares of Antero Resources Corporation (NYSE:AR - Free Report) by 26.6% during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 71,024 shares of the oil and natural gas company's stock after acquiring an additional 14,944 shares during the quarter. VELA Investment Management LLC's holdings in Antero Resources were worth $2,861,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Antero Resources (NYSE:AR -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, July 30th. The oil and natural gas company reported $0.35 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.68 by ($0.33). The business had revenue of $1.30 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.30 billion. Antero Resources had a net margin of 10.13% and a return on equity of 6.48%. The company's revenue was up 32.6%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ted ($0.21) earnings per share. As a group, analysts forecast that Antero Resources Corporation will post 2.74 EPS for the current year.

Antero Resources Corporation, an independent oil and natural gas company, engages in the development, production, exploration, and acquisition of natural gas, natural gas liquids (NGLs), and oil properties in the United States. It operates in three segments: Exploration and Development; Marketing; and Equity Method Investment in Antero Midstream.
